Mountain biking around Roncegno Terme offers diverse terrain within the Valsugana Valley, at the foot of Monte Fravòrt. The region features the extensive Lagorai Mountain Chain, providing a network of challenging mountain bike trails. The Brenta River carves through the valley, and nearby lakes like Caldonazzo and Levico also contribute to the varied landscape. The hills are characterized by chestnut groves and dense woodlands, offering a mix of ascents and descents.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the general difficulty level of mountain bike trails around Roncegno Terme?

The mountain bike trails around Roncegno Terme are predominantly challenging, with 11 out of 14 routes rated as difficult. There are also 3 moderate trails available for those seeking a less strenuous ride. The region, nestled at the foot of Monte Fravòrt and within the Lagorai Mountain Chain, offers significant elevation changes and technical terrain.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ails for beginners in Roncegno Terme?

While the majority of trails are rated moderate to difficult, Roncegno Terme is situated in the Valsugana Valley, which features the scenic Valsugana Cycle Path. This path, connecting Lake Caldonazzo and Lake Levico with Bassano del Grappa, offers a gentler option suitable for beginners or those looking for a more relaxed ride. For specific mountain bike trails, there are no routes explicitly categorized as 'easy' in the immediate area, but the 3 moderate trails could be suitable for improving riders.

What natural features or landmarks can I expect to see while mountain biking around Roncegno Terme?

You'll encounter diverse landscapes, from the high-altitude nature of the Lagorai Mountain Chain to the green Valsugana Valley carved by the Brenta River. Notable natural features include the nearby Lake Caldonazzo and Lake Levico, as well as the protected Biotope of Roncegno with its riparian forest. The hills are also dotted with picturesque chestnut groves.

Are there any scenic viewpoints along the mountain bike trails?

Yes, many trails offer panoramic views. For instance, the route Borgo Valsugana – Italia Junction loop from Roncegno Bagni-Marter provides extensive views across the Valsugana Valley. The region's position at the foot of Monte Fravòrt and opposite Cima Dodici ensures a mountainous backdrop with numerous scenic vistas.

When is the best time of year for mountain biking in Roncegno Terme?

The best time for mountain biking in Roncegno Terme is typically from spring through autumn. The region offers diverse terrain, from valley paths to high-altitude routes in the Lagorai Mountain Chain. Summer provides warm weather, while spring and autumn offer milder temperatures and vibrant scenery, especially with the chestnut groves changing colors. High-altitude trails might be inaccessible due to snow in winter.

Are there family-friendly mountain bike trails in Roncegno Terme?

While the dedicated mountain bike trails around Roncegno Terme are generally rated moderate to difficult, the broader Valsugana Valley offers excellent family-friendly cycling opportunities. The Valsugana Cycle Path is a great option for families, providing a scenic and mostly flat route along the Brenta River, connecting the lakes of Caldonazzo and Levico.

Can I bring my dog on the mountain bike trails in Roncegno Terme?

Generally, dogs are permitted on mountain bike trails in the Roncegno Terme area, especially on natural paths and forest roads. However, it's always advisable to keep your dog on a leash, particularly in protected areas like the Biotope of Roncegno, or when encountering wildlife or other trail users. Always ensure your dog is well-behaved and that you clean up after them.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y the most about mountain biking in Roncegno Terme?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 1300 reviews. Mountain bikers often praise the diverse terrain, from challenging mountain routes in the Lagorai chain to scenic valley paths, and the breathtaking natural beauty of the Valsugana Valley, including the lakes and chestnut groves.

Are there any circular mountain bike routes available?

Yes, many of the mountain bike routes around Roncegno Terme are designed as loops. For example, you can explore the high-altitude Lagorai chain on the La Lupa del Lagorai – Lago delle Prese loop from Rifugio Serot, or experience the Brenta River valley on the Borgo Valsugana – Waterfall on the Brenta River loop from Roncegno Bagni-Marter.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the mountain bike trails?

The terrain varies significantly. In the Lagorai Mountain Chain, expect challenging ascents and descents on natural singletracks and forest roads. The Valsugana Valley offers smoother paths, including the dedicated cycle path. You'll ride through dense woodlands, open meadows, and past chestnut groves, often with rocky sections and roots on the more technical mountain routes.

Are there any specific attractions or points of interest near the trails for a post-ride visit?

After a ride, you can relax at the renowned thermal baths of Roncegno Terme, known for their therapeutic waters. The thermal park also features an outdoor swimming pool. For cultural interest, the Historic Center of Borgo Valsugana and the Historic center of Levico Terme are also nearby.
